The manager of The Cheesecake Factory in Boston reports that on six randomly selected weekdays, the number of customers served was 120, 130, 100, 205, 185, and 220. She believes that the number of customers served on weekdays follows a normal distribution. Construct the 90% confidence interval for the average number of customers served on weekdays. (You may find it useful to reference the t table. Round intermediate calculations to at least 4 decimal places. Round "sample mean" and "sample standard deviation" to 2 decimal places and "t" value to 3 decimal places and final answers to 2 decimal places.)
